It uses Selenium and Chromedriver to extract valid guest passes from CrunchyRoll and PRAW to publish it /r/Crunchyroll's weekly Megathread. This is not a bot made to run indefinitely; however, it can be altered to do so if one so desired. It was intended for use in conjunction with a task scheduler/cronjob to check once every month (or four if you wish to publish them in sets before guest passes expire) for new guest passes. ## Changes: Due to how the PRAW library has changed, all users now must create a [reddit script app](https://github.com/reddit/reddit/wiki/OAuth2). As such, the data file now must include additional data. See below for a quick guide on how to set this up. As of `4.0.0`, binaries for `chromedriver` and other tooling will not be included. Please refer to [link](https://github.com/SeleniumHQ/selenium/wiki/ChromeDriver#quick-installation) on setting up and installing `chromedriver`. ## Setting Up Reddit Account: 1. Log on to the bot account. 2. Go the bot account's `preferences` from the upper-right corner. 3. Click the `apps` tab. 4. Click the `create another app`. - The button test may appear differently if you have no apps setup. 5. In the prompts, ensure that the `script` radio button is toggled and `redirected uri` is is set to `http://localhost:8080`. The other fields can be filled with whatever you want. 6. Click `create app` button when done. 7. You should now see the app created. Right below the name and below `personal use script` will be your `client_id`. Within the box, to the right of the word `secret`, is your `client_secret`. ## Prerequisites: You will need to have Chrome installed on your system at its default installation path. This is due to the `chromedriver` working with your Chrome installation to retrieve Crunchyroll Guest Pass. **Note** As of `4.0.0`, `chromedriver` will not be provided. Please refer to [link](https://github.com/SeleniumHQ/selenium/wiki/ChromeDriver#quick-installation) on setting up. ## Install: `pip install crunchy-bot` ## Setup: Run `crunchy init` to generate config file: ```json { "crunchy_username": "crunchy_user", "crunchy_password": "crunchy_pass", "reddit_client_id": "client_id", "reddit_client_secret": "client_secret", "reddit_user_agent": "CrunchyBot:v4.0.0 (hosted by /u/{YOUR_USERNAME})", "reddit_username": "reddit_user", "reddit_password": "reddit_pass", "log_dir": "/tmp/crunchybot/logs" } ``` or save this to `~/.crunchybot`. Execute `crunchy publish [--config path/to/.crunchybot] [--debug/-d]` to start scrapping and publishing. ## Development ### With Pipenv Assuming you have `pipenv` installed on your system, run the following within the repo: ``` $ pipenv --three ``` This will setup a virtual environment for Crunchybot to work in without interferring your other python projects. With `pipenv` initialized, run: ``` $ pipenv install ``` This will use the `Pipfile` and `Pipfile.lock` to fetch and verify dependencies. Run `pipenv shell` to execute a shell into the generated virtual environment. ### Without Pipenv Install PRAW and Selenium by running the following command: ``` $ pip install -r requirements.txt ``` Once setup with or without `pipenv`, run `pip install -e .` within the repository. This should install a local version of `crunchy_bot` and its cli. This will also generate a `version.py` using `setuptools_scm`. Make and test your changes locally. Pull Request are welcome. ## Automating: ### OSX/Linux Run `crontab -e` and add ``` 0 0 1 * * zsh -lc "/path/to/crunchy publish" ``` You can replace `zsh -lc` with your shell's equivalent. This is mainly to execute any of your profile presets that may handle setting up `PATH` and other required environment variables to run. ### Windows Add the Python script to the Windows Task Scheduler with monthly frequency. Here is a [link](https://blog.netwrix.com/2018/07/03/how-to-automate-powershell-scripts-with-task-scheduler/) to setup the Task Scheduler. ### Github You can also fork this repository and utilize `Github Actions` to run this task on the first of each month.
